Example: consumer debt hit $2.5-trillion at the end of the first quarter of 2024, according to the latest credit trends report from Equifax Canada. Yup, that's a lot of debt. But what does it mean to individual households with mortgages and other types of debt? Here are some numbers in the Equifax report that tell the story: The approximate number of people who missed a payment on a mortgage in the first quarter, up 22.7 per cent from a year earlier. $1-billion: The total balance of mortgages in severe delinquency – 90 days or more without payment – crossed this threshold in the first quarter for the first time in Ontario. That's double the pre-pandemic level. Almost 9 per cent of people renewing a mortgage in the first quarter of this year saw their monthly payments rise by this much. 1.26-million: The number of people who missed at least one payment on some type of credit in the first quarter.
